Everyone does the math wrong on these. You don't compare the difference of bricks in the boxes to the cost of individual bricks online. You would compare how many boxes of loose bricks you'd need to buy compared to boxes of stacked bricks. If a PAB wall box is $8, and you need 1.5 boxes of loose bricks to equal one box of stacked bricks, the stacking saves you $4. $4 for half an hour of work.
